“”Tim Wise’s speech “Diversity, Unity, and Student Success” spoke about how the biggest problem is “the Other” and “the Norm.” That is to say, the norm being the dominant culture and the other being the inferior group. There is no interrogating the norm because they do not open up about subjects either than themselves, and they won’t shift their focus. I agree with Wise because he makes a point about the norm having blinders. They do not see discrimination unless it is towards them. He spoke about the Minnesota Nice and believing they’re diverse, but in reality, to the other group, they are behaving in a passive-aggressive way. Being overly nice but discriminative behind closed doors. The norm cannot be questioned about their racism towards the other because they do not see themselves as wrongdoers.

Wise goes on to speak about racial stereotypes and that the norm often believes that Blacks, women, LGBT have an equal opportunity. They’re blinded to the racial injustices and inequity. Wise states, that even children can tell there is inequality. The norm show a consistent “lens” to the truth about racism. Believing that people of color are exaggerating about racism and inequality. White people default to there own understanding. While judges have a “lens” towards White and Black offenders, showing favoritism towards White offenders because they don’t look as aggressive as Black offenders. If the norm removed the blinders and acknowledge their own biases than they can take responsibility for the kind of person they truly are.

Taking the project implicit tests showed me that even I have a lens and that according to the test see Black people as more violent and Whites as more innocent. I honestly think the test itself is biased, and I do not think either one has a violent or innocence. I see all people as equal until they show their true colors. I have a best friend who is White and Filipino, we’ve been friends since we were 18 and now we’re 34. I have seen our friendship flourish and never once questioned if she was a racist.
Wise makes a profound point in his speech and it allows me to see that not all White people are racist.””
